Forever Entertainment have announced that Front Mission 2: Remake release date of June 12, 2023, will be pushed back to an unknown (new) release date. Sigh, yet another delay in line, it is becoming an industry standard, it seems.


The press release states the following: “This decision was not taken lightly but in collaboration with the development team, we want to ensure that we have sufficient time to add as many functionalities as possible while proceeding with proper implementation and tests, in order to meet your expectations for a modern-day remake.”


“While we are currently unable to provide a specific revised premiere date, we assure you that we are working tirelessly to complete the project as soon as possible, with the aim of releasing the game in the third quarter of this year.”


No release date has been given but I guess we can sleep more easily by knowing they are working hard to ensure that the game launches in the third quarter this year.


Front Mission 2: Remake is coming to Nintendo Switch at some point in the third quarter of 2023.
